A dead simple Go library for sending notifications to various messaging services.

About

Notify arose from my own need for one of my api server running in production to be able to notify me when, for example, an error occurred. The library is kept as simple as possible to allow a quick integration and easy usage.

Install

go get -u github.com/nikoksr/notify

Example usage

// The notifier we're gonna send our messages to
notifier := notify.New()

// Create a telegram service. Ignoring error for demo simplicity
telegramService, _ := telegram.New("your_telegram_api_token")

// Passing a telegram chat id as receiver for our messages.
// Basically where should our message be sent to?
telegramService.AddReceivers("-1234567890")

// Tell our notifier to use the telegram service. You can repeat the above process
// for as many services as you like and just tell the notifier to use them.
// Its kinda like using middlewares for api servers.
notifier.UseService(telegramService)

// Send a test message
_ = notifier.Send(
	"Message Subject/Title",
	"The actual message. Hello, you awesome gophers! :)",
)

Supported services

  • Discord
  • Email
  • Microsoft Teams
  • Slack
  • Telegram
  • Pushbullet

Variables

View Source
var ErrSendNotification = errors.New("send notification")

ErrSendNotification signals that the notifier failed to send a notification.

Functions

This section is empty.

Types

type Notifier

type Notifier interface {
	Send(string, string) error
	AddReceivers(...string)
}

Notifier defines the behavior for notification services. It implements Send and AddReciever

The Send command simply sends a message string to the internal destination Notifier.

E.g for telegram it sends the message to the specified group chat.

The AddReceivers takes one or many strings and adds these to the list of destinations for recieving messages e.g. slack channels, telegram chats, email addresses.

type Notify

type Notify struct {
	Disabled bool
	// contains filtered or unexported fields
}

Notify is the central struct for managing notification services and sending messages to them.

func New

func New() *Notify

New returns a new instance of Notify. Defaulting to being not disabled

func (Notify) Send

func (n Notify) Send(subject, message string) error

Send calls the underlying notification services to send the given message to their respective endpoints.

func (*Notify) UseService

func (n *Notify) UseService(service Notifier)

UseService adds a given service to the notifiers services list.
